Pine Ridge School (PRS) is a Bureau of Indian Education (BIE)-operated K-12 school in Pine Ridge, South Dakota. [1] It is within the Pine Ridge Indian Reservation. Its high school program is one of five high schools that are within the reservation boundaries. [2] The school's cornerstone was placed on February 8, 1879. [3]
